A bootable ISO is a type of image file that contains a fully functional operating system, which can be booted directly from a CD, DVD, or USB drive. In the case of HDD Regenerator, the bootable ISO allows you to create a bootable media that can be used to start your computer and run the HDD Regenerator tool, bypassing the need for a functioning operating system.

HDD Regenerator is a legacy DOS-based application. If your modern computer fails to recognize the USB drive, restart and enter your BIOS setup (via F2 or DEL). Navigate to the security or boot tab, disable Secure Boot , and enable Legacy Boot or CSM (Compatibility Support Module) .
